Abu Dhabi Ship Building (ADSB) is a shipbuilding company established in 1996 in the United Arab Emirates. [2] It specializes in the construction, repair, and refit of naval and commercial vessels. ADSB serves as a key defense asset for the UAE, providing a range of services including the building and maintenance of various types of ships and marine components. [3]
Established in 1995, Abu Dhabi Ship Building was formed as a joint venture between the Government of Abu Dhabi and Newport News Shipbuilding (NNS). [4] Emiri Decree No. 5 of 1995 officially mandated ADSB to develop an industrial base for constructing a wide range of vessels, marine components, and equipment, in addition to conducting maintenance and repair operations. [5] The company has since grown significantly, solidifying its position as a key player in the naval defense sector and a vital asset for the UAE. [6] [7]
ADSB constructs and maintains naval and commercial vessels at its shipyard in Abu Dhabi's Mussafah Industrial Zone, spanning over 300,000 square meters. [6] Its portfolio includes frigates, offshore patrol vessels, and fast patrol vessels. It also provides associated maintenance, repair, and engineering services. [8]
